NOTE: MasterCard Zero Liability covers U.S.-issued cards only; and does not apply to ATM transactions, PIN transactions not processed by MasterCard, or certain commercial card transactions.

The MasterCard Zero Liability Policy might not apply if you have not used reasonable care in protecting your Card from loss or theft or you have not promptly reported to SVB when you knew that your Card was lost or stolen.
